Role Purpose: To support the Supply Chain function with the day to day management of the end to end supply of specified product range(s), managing the stock flow plan either through automated system replenishment or push allocations. You will assist with the forecast of stock requirements and managing stock/product flow whilst maintaining correct store and Distribution Centre stock levels to service demand in order to ensure availability and stock targets are achieved.  

What's the job?

  • Support the supply chain team in ensuring forecasting and replenishment is set up to maximise availability     
  • Delivering stock/inventory days targets to deliver the sales plan across all selling channels.   
  • Raise import and domestic orders where requested.  
  • Manage order proposals produced by the forecasting and replenishment system  
  • Create the Distribution Centre (DC) store and on-line inputs of products.  
  • Ensure orders are raised in a timely manner.  
  • Amend orders and ensure all systems are aligned with the correct data.  
  • Log all orders raised, amended, shipped and received into DC.  
  • Run reports as requested by Stock Team on order management and product flow.   
  • Manage our international and domestic Vendors ensuring compliance with our requirements.  
  • Run reports at request from Supply Chain Analysts as and when required.  
  • Support the Supply Chain Analysts in all Import/Domestic related administrative tasks.  
  • Review and challenge processes and procedures (internal and external).  
  • Train team members in correct usage of procedures, processes and documentation.  
  • Ensure information is keyed accurately and meets required deadlines.  
  • Use the tools and reports available to manage store replenishment, (including blocking replenishment as required)
